What is numerical analysis?

A Numerical Analysis job involves developing and applying mathematical algorithms to solve complex numerical problems. Professionals in this field use computational techniques to approximate solutions for equations that may not have analytical solutions. They work in areas such as engineering, physics, finance, and computer science to optimize simulations, data analysis, and modeling. Strong skills in programming, mathematics, and problem-solving are essential for success in this role.

What kinds of projects do professionals in numerical analysis typically work on?

Professionals in Numerical Analysis often work on projects involving the development and implementation of algorithms to solve complex mathematical problems, such as simulations, optimizations, and predictive modeling. Their work is typically applied to fields like engineering design, finance, data science, and scientific computing, where accurate numerical solutions are vital. On a daily basis, they may collaborate with engineers, scientists, and software developers to ensure models reflect real-world scenarios and produce reliable results. This collaborative and interdisciplinary approach offers plenty of opportunities to broaden expertise and progress into more specialized or senior analytical roles.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in numerical analysis, and why are they important?

To thrive in Numerical Analysis, you need a strong background in mathematics, statistics, and computational methods, typically supported by a degree in applied mathematics, engineering, or a related field. Familiarity with programming languages (such as MATLAB, Python, or R) and proficiency in numerical simulation or modeling software are crucial. Attention to detail, analytical thinking, and effective communication stand out as valuable soft skills in this specialty. These competencies are critical for developing accurate numerical solutions and collaborating effectively within interdisciplinary technical teams.
